Transaction

bbccb081e0c19f00294f1dc5a883cd514af108171994c21eba77c80516c71fef
539,623 confirmations
Timestamp
1457380280
Block401,603
Fee25,000 sats
Fee rate67 sats/vB
view on mempool.space

Inputs & Outputs